RCH-155 Howitzer: Ukraine’s Advanced Artillery Support

Ukraine has officially received its first RCH-155 self-propelled howitzer from Germany, marking a significant milestone as the first foreign operator of this cutting-edge artillery system. The handover, which took place in Kassel, Germany, was overseen by German Defense Minister Boris Pistorius. This delivery underscores Germany’s commitment to bolstering Ukraine’s defenses against ongoing Russian aggression, with plans to supply a total of 54 RCH-155 howitzers to the Ukrainian military.

During the handover ceremony, Minister Pistorius emphasized the importance of this delivery, stating, “This delivery is a clear signal that Ukraine can count on our support.” The agreement for the howitzers was initially announced in December 2022, when Ukraine secured a deal for 18 units. Following this, additional commitments raised the total to 54 units, aimed at enhancing Ukraine’s ground assault capabilities.

The RCH-155: A Cutting-Edge Artillery System

The RCH-155 is widely regarded as one of the most advanced wheeled artillery systems available today. It features a Boxer armored personnel carrier chassis, combined with an automated artillery turret, which allows for enhanced operational efficiency. With a standard firing range of 50 kilometers (31 miles), the howitzer can extend its range to 70 kilometers (43.5 miles) when using advanced Vulcano rounds, showcasing its formidable striking capabilities.

In addition to its impressive range, the RCH-155 is designed for mobility, capable of reaching speeds of up to 100 kilometers (62 miles) per hour on various terrains. This mobility is further enhanced by advanced fire control systems and a robust suspension system that includes double-wishbone coil springs and shock absorbers. Defense analysts and media outlets alike have dubbed the RCH-155 an ‘engineering marvel,’ highlighting its sophisticated design and operational versatility.
